Q1= Jan+Feb+March
Q2= April+May+June
Q3= July+Aug+Sept
Q4= Oct+Nov+Dec

Red= Smart Phone (High End)
Blue= Smart Phone (Mid or Low end)
Orange= Feature Phone
Green= Basic Phone
Black= Device / unknown


                                                    2011
Moto Cliq 2 ------------------------ Jan 19th (Android 2.2 w/ MotoBlur | 7.2-10.2 HSPA)
Dell Streak 7" ---------------------- Feb 2nd (Android 2.2 w/ StageUI | 21 HSPA+)
Samsung T259 --------------------- Feb 9th
Nokia X2 (prepaid) ----------------- Feb 16th
Samsung Galaxy S 4G -------------- Feb 23rd (aka Vibrant 4G) (Android 2.2 w/ TouchWiz | 4" | 1GHz H.bird | 21 HSPA+)
Jet 2.0 4G ------------------------ March 23rd (21 HSPA+ data stick w/o International WCDMA bands)
Nokia Astound --------------------- April 6th (aka C7/Tiger) (S^3.1 | 3.5" | 10.2 HSPA)


<a href="http://www.tmonews.com/2011/03/t-mobile-launching-dell-inspiron-n4010-march-21st/ ">Dell 14R Notebook[/url] ------------------- April (Win7 Premium | 1st Gen i3 | 250GB HDD | HSPA+ & Wifi) (Dell.com ONLY)
Rocket 3.0 -------------------------- April (DC 42 HSPA+ Data Stick w/ International WCDMA bands | aGPS)
Mobile Hotspot (WiFi AP) "Wayne" ---- April (DC 42 HSPA+ w/ International WCDMA bands | aGPS)
Mobile Hotspot (WiFi AP) "Lil Wayne" -- April (21 HSPA+ w/o International WCDMA bands)
G-Slate --------------------------- April 20th (Android 3.0 Tablet by LG | 10" | 1GHz Tegra 2 | 21 HSPA+)
LG G2x ---------------------------- April 20th (aka Optimus 2X) (Android 2.2.2 | 4" | 1GHz Tegra 2 | 14.4 HSPA+)
Samsung Sidekick 4G -------------- April 20th (Android 2.2 | 3.5" | 1GHz H.Bird | 21 HSPA+)
HTC Flyer (Tablet) -------------------- Q2 (Android 2.3 w/ Scribe Sense | 7" | 1.5GHz | 14.4 HSPA+)
G-Surf ------------------------------- Q2? (Tablet?)
Readers Cafe ------------------------- Q2? (Tmo Tablet Marketplace? - Blio e-reading software?)
HTC Pyramid ----------------------- Summer (Android 2.3.2 w/ Sense 3.0 | 4.3" qHD | 1.2GHz 8260 | 14.4 HSPA+)
HTC myTouch 4G Slide ------------- Summer (Android 2.3.x w/ Espresso | 3.8" | 1.2GHz 8260 | 14.4 HSPA+)
LG Optimus 3D --------------------- Summer? (LG 920) (Android 2.2+ | 4.3" | 1GHz OMAP4)
BB Storm 3 ------------------------ Summer? (6.1 | 3.7" | 1.2GHz | HSPA)
BB Dakota (Bold) ------------------- Summer? (6.1 | 2.8" touchscreen | HSPA)
BB Apollo (Curve) ------------------ Summer? (6.1 | 800MHz | 7.2 HSPA)
BB Playbook ----------------------- Summer? (QNX | 7" | 1GHz dual-core | WiFi)
4 upcoming Nokia Symbian devices ---- 2011
LG Thunder -------------------------- 2011


T-Mobile Cel-Fi (Signal Booster) ----- unknown (Needs slight Tmo signal | Available now (for select markets?) via CS/611)
HSPA+ Home Router? --------------- unknown (21-28mbps)
